Your Result: Methodist
 
As a Methodist, your views can be traced back to John Wesley and his revival movement within the Church of England. Methodist beliefs are broadly speaking similar to those of the mainstream reformed churches, however Methodists have a tradition of enjoying more better relations with episcopalian churces. After all, John Wesley himself remained a committed Anglican clergyman. Methodists mainly embrace the writing of Arminius, believing that while faith is central to salvation, that salvation can be lost through rejecting God. One of the biggest theological differences between Methodists and other reformed faiths is the Methodist belief in free will, and that men choose to sin, rather than being born as its slaves.
